In 2009, Forrester described the smarter buyers in this market as those looking at infrastructure outsourcing as a way to deliver near-term cost savings while positioning IT as a business enabler rather than a keep-the-lights-on tax on the firm.

In 2026, Forrester's description of what separates Leaders in this market includes positioning infrastructure outsourcing as an enabler of business transformation rather than just technology support.

Seventeen years apart, and the same sentence. The industry has been promising to move beyond cost arbitrage since before the iPad existed, and an analyst firm is still using that transition as the marker of leadership.

That persistence is the most honest thing to know about this category. The promise is real, some providers deliver it, and the gravitational pull toward cost has never weakened.

What is actually being bought

Infrastructure outsourcing hands responsibility for running technology infrastructure to a third party. Compute, storage, networking, data centre operations, end-user computing, service desk, and the operational disciplines around them: monitoring, patching, incident response, capacity management, and disaster recovery.

Forrester's current Landscape framing describes the value as consistent, reliable, scalable infrastructure management, the ability to address regional and local requirements, and support for experimenting with and adopting new technologies.

The middle item deserves attention because it is the one organisations underweight. A multinational running operations across a dozen countries faces different regulatory requirements, different data residency rules, different labour arrangements, and different local suppliers in each. A provider that already operates in all of them is selling coverage that would take years to build internally, and that is frequently worth more than the hourly rate difference.

Seventeen years of renaming

Forrester has scored this market repeatedly and changed its name four times, which tracks how the industry wanted to be seen at each point.

The Q1 2009 evaluation was Global IT Infrastructure Outsourcing, authored by Paul Roehrig, covering fifteen firms against thirty one criteria plus a twenty five item reference client survey. Cognizant entered the Leaders for the first time.

The Q1 2011 edition reviewed nineteen providers against thirty six criteria, with Tata Consultancy Services placing as a Leader and taking the highest customer reference scores of any vendor evaluated.

The Q1 2015 edition dropped IT from the name, becoming Global Infrastructure Outsourcing. Capgemini placed as a Leader, with its own commentary emphasising cloud brokering, service integration, orchestration, and aggregation.

The Q4 2017 edition was titled Next-Generation Infrastructure Outsourcing, scoring fifteen providers against twenty four criteria: Accenture, Atos, Capgemini, CGI, Cognizant, DXC Technology, Fujitsu, HCLTech, IBM, Infosys, NTT DATA, TCS, Tech Mahindra, Unisys, and Wipro.

Next-generation is a revealing choice of adjective. It signals a market whose established version had become unattractive enough that the research needed to distinguish the modern kind.

The Q4 2024 edition settled on Infrastructure Outsourcing Services, covering thirteen providers, and the Q3 2026 edition published on 28 July 2026 under the same name, following a Landscape in Q1 2026.

Nineteen providers in 2011, fifteen in 2017, thirteen in 2024. Steady contraction among firms that were already very large.

What distinguishes Leaders in 2026

Forrester's characterisation of the current Leaders describes superior current offering scores across compute, storage, networking, data centre, resiliency, and advanced operations, with strong strategy scores covering vision, sustained innovation, partner ecosystems, pricing flexibility, talent strategy, and global delivery.

Three themes in the current evaluation are worth separating out.

AI-first operations, meaning zero-touch operations and predictive automation applied to infrastructure management rather than sold as a client-facing capability. This is the provider automating its own delivery.

Digital twins augmenting observability, allowing scenario modelling and anticipation of operational outcomes rather than reacting to them. Simulating a change before applying it to a production estate is a genuinely useful capability and a difficult one.

And sustainability, with data centre services assessed on energy optimisation. That has moved from a reporting requirement to a scored capability, which reflects both cost pressure and regulatory disclosure obligations.

The pattern across all three is the provider industrialising its own operations. Which brings the pricing question directly into view.

Why cost keeps winning

The transformation promise has been available since 2009 and cost remains the dominant purchase driver. The reason is structural rather than a failure of imagination.

Cost savings are contractible. You can write a number in an agreement, measure it, and hold someone to it. Transformation is not contractible in the same way. It depends on the client's willingness to change how it works, on decisions made outside the provider's control, and on outcomes attributable to many causes.

Procurement functions are measured on the first. Nobody gets promoted for signing a contract whose benefits are described as strategic and realised over five years.

There is a second reason that providers do not raise. A transformation that genuinely modernises a client's estate reduces the operational effort required to run it, which reduces the revenue from running it. A provider paid per unit of effort has no commercial reason to eliminate effort quickly.

That conflict is the same one visible in Forrester's coverage of application modernisation and multicloud managed services, where customers worried explicitly that an end-to-end provider would optimise on the run side what it should have optimised on the build side. It applies here in the same form.

The organisations that resolve it write the modernisation outcome into the commercial model, with committed cost reductions tied to the estate actually simplifying. The ones that do not discover that year three of a seven-year contract looks a great deal like year one.

What cloud did, and did not, do

A reasonable question is why this category survived the cloud transition at all. If infrastructure moves to hyperscale providers, the argument goes, there is nothing left to outsource.

That prediction was wrong in a specific and instructive way.

Cloud changed what infrastructure is without reducing how much of it there is. An enterprise running three cloud platforms, a private cloud, remaining data centres, edge locations, and a set of systems nobody will migrate has a more complex operational estate than one running two data centres, not a simpler one.

It also changed the skill requirement rather than removing it. Managing cloud infrastructure well requires cost management, security posture, identity, network architecture, and automation expertise that is scarce and expensive, which is precisely the condition under which outsourcing makes sense.

What cloud did remove is the asset transfer that used to anchor these deals. Historically an outsourcing contract involved the provider buying the client's data centres and hiring its staff, which created switching costs so high that the relationship was effectively permanent. Without that anchor, contracts are shorter, more contestable, and more frequently multi-sourced.

That is better for buyers and it explains the contraction in provider count, since a market with lower switching costs rewards scale and punishes the mid-sized.

The arbitrage question returns

The labour model underneath this industry is facing the same pressure visible across every services category in this series.

Infrastructure outsourcing was built on wage arbitrage plus process discipline: do the work somewhere cheaper, standardise it, and apply economies of scale across many clients. That model created several very large companies.

Automation has been eroding it for a decade and agentic operations accelerate that. If monitoring, first-line triage, patching, and routine remediation are increasingly performed by software, the headcount that the pricing model rests on shrinks.

The Leaders being credited for zero-touch operations and predictive automation are doing exactly this to themselves, which is the correct strategic response and produces an obvious commercial question for buyers: if the provider needs fewer people to deliver the service, does the price reflect that, or does the margin?

That question is negotiable in a way it was not five years ago, because the provider has publicly claimed the productivity gain in an analyst evaluation. A vendor citing its automation maturity has supplied the evidence for the conversation.

What the reference process reveals

One detail worth noting about how these evaluations work, because it affects how much weight to place on them.

Forrester's methodology draws on customer references supplied by the vendors themselves, and participation varies. In the current evaluation, at least one provider's assessment notes an unusually thin reference response.

That is worth reading as information rather than as an accusation. A large provider unable to surface engaged reference customers for an analyst evaluation is telling you something about the state of its client relationships, and it is the kind of signal that does not appear in a capability score.

The broader point for any services evaluation is that references are the most useful and least standardised input. Ask providers for references matching your profile in scale, geography, and estate complexity, and treat a provider's reluctance as data.

Alongside that, the common thread in customer feedback across this category's history is governance. Reference customers repeatedly emphasise the need to actively manage the relationship, set expectations, and define governance models early. That is the least glamorous advice available and it remains the most consistent predictor of whether these arrangements work.
